#include <log4cxx/logstring.h>
#include <log4cxx/helpers/condition.h>
#include <log4cxx/helpers/exception.h>
#include <apr_thread_cond.h>
#include <log4cxx/helpers/synchronized.h>
#include <log4cxx/helpers/pool.h>
#include <log4cxx/helpers/thread.h>
using namespace log4cxx::helpers;
using namespace log4cxx;
Condition::Condition(Pool& p)
{
#if APR_HAS_THREADS
apr_status_t stat = apr_thread_cond_create(&condition, p.getAPRPool());
if (stat != APR_SUCCESS)
{
throw RuntimeException(stat);
}
#endif
}
Condition::~Condition()
{
#if APR_HAS_THREADS
apr_thread_cond_destroy(condition);
#endif
}
log4cxx_status_t Condition::signalAll()
{
#if APR_HAS_THREADS
return apr_thread_cond_broadcast(condition);
#else
return APR_SUCCESS;
#endif
}
void Condition::await(Mutex& mutex)
{
#if APR_HAS_THREADS
if (Thread::interrupted())
{
throw InterruptedException();
}
apr_status_t stat = apr_thread_cond_wait(
condition,
mutex.getAPRMutex());
if (stat != APR_SUCCESS)
{
throw InterruptedException(stat);
}
#endif
}
